Heritage Exposition Services is seeking a Customer Service Representative to ensure a superior exhibitor experience, manage orders, deliver on-site support, and coordinate shipments with internal teams to run events smoothly.
The ideal candidate has 1–3 years in customer service or event support, strong skills in Excel, Outlook, Word, and Google Docs, and excellent verbal and written communication. Travel to trade shows may be required.
The Customer Service Representative (CSR) plays a critical role in ensuring a superior customer experience and supporting event service requirements. This individual is responsible for order execution, exhibitor support, on‑site trade show services, and vendor product shipments. As a frontline customer contact, the CSR must be organized, detail‑oriented, and proactive, with the ability to multi‑task and effectively communicate with clients and internal teams. This position requires collaboration with various departments to establish production schedules and ensure smooth execution on‑site.

This position is full‑time and in‑person, requiring regular travel to trade show sites and on‑site customer service operations. Travel will be required for event setup, execution, and teardown, and employees must be available for weekend work and extended hours as needed, depending on show schedules. Frequent periods of sitting, standing, walking, and typing. Ability to lift up to 25 lbs.. Periodic bending, reaching, twisting, carrying, pushing, and pulling.
